Visible Decay and Damages



If you notice substantial visible decay or damage on your tree, it might be time to consider removing it from your property.

Noticeable indicators of degeneration, such as big dental caries, deep fractures, or comprehensive decomposing areas, can damage the tree's structure and pose a safety and security threat. Dead branches, peeling off bark, or fungal development on the trunk are additionally indications that the tree's health and wellness is compromised.

These concerns can make the tree more vulnerable to toppling over throughout strong winds or tornados, potentially causing damages to your residential property or posing a risk to people close by.

Furthermore, trees with significant decay or damage might not recoup despite expert treatment and maintenance. By promptly resolving trees revealing visible indicators of damage, you can prevent mishaps and guard your home.

Leaning or Unsteady Tree



When observing a tree on your residential or commercial property that's visibly leaning to one side or appears unstable, it's essential to evaluate the circumstance immediately. Leaning trees can be an indicator of architectural problems or root damage that may compromise the tree's security. An unsteady tree postures a substantial danger of falling, possibly creating damages to your home or posing a safety and security hazard to individuals nearby.



To identify the seriousness of the scenario, begin by assessing the angle of the lean and whether it has actually been gradually getting worse gradually. Examine the tree for any visible indicators of damage, such as splits in the trunk or exposed roots.

If the tree is leaning as a result of root concerns, it might not be salvageable and could present a better risk as time takes place.

If you see a tree on your property that's leaning or unsteady, it's recommended to get in touch with a professional arborist to examine the tree's health and wellness and suggest the most effective strategy, which may include tree removal to prevent any potential mishaps or damages.

Overhanging Branches and Deadwood



Worried concerning the trees on your residential property? Overhanging branches and nonessential can present major risks that suggest it's time to eliminate a tree.

Branches that extend over your house, garage, or other structures can become dangerous throughout storms, possibly creating damages or injury if they break off.

Nonessential, which are branches that have died and not shed from the tree, can also fall all of a sudden, posturing a danger to anyone listed below.

It's critical to resolve looming branches and deadwood without delay to prevent mishaps. Frequently evaluate your trees for indications of deadwood or branches extending too far. If you notice any kind of, it's ideal to have a specialist arborist assess the circumstance. They can safely get rid of the unsafe branches or advise tree elimination if the risks are expensive.
